
The Christmas Day Truce defines Humanity

The Christmas Day Truce defines Humanity There are moments in History that are said to define us as a species and echo through even to modern day. All too often people draw upon the darker pages of the past to demonstrate how we are still beasts. The blood thirsty roar from the crowds in the […]